CPU Cores and Base Frequency

The Qualcomm Snapdragon X Plus (X1P-64-100) is a 10 core processor with a clock frequency of 1.00 GHz (3.40 GHz). The processor can compute 10 threads at the same time. The Intel Core Ultra 5 135H clocks with 1.70 GHz (4.60 GHz), has 14 CPU cores and can calculate 18 threads in parallel.

Memory & PCIe

Up to 64 GB of memory in a maximum of 8 memory channels is supported by the Qualcomm Snapdragon X Plus (X1P-64-100), while the Intel Core Ultra 5 135H supports a maximum of 96 GB of memory with a maximum memory bandwidth of 120.0 GB/s enabled.

Thermal Management

The Qualcomm Snapdragon X Plus (X1P-64-100) has a TDP of 23 W. The TDP of the Intel Core Ultra 5 135H is 28 W. System integrators use the TDP of the processor as a guide when dimensioning the cooling solution.

Cinebench 2024 (Single-Core)

The Cinebench 2024 benchmark is based on the Redshift rendering engine, which is also used in Maxon's 3D program Cinema 4D. The benchmark runs are each 10 minutes long to test whether the processor is limited by its heat generation.
